- Former U.S. Federal Reserve Chairman Ben Bernanke is having a “hard time” refinancing his home loan due to the tight credit conditions in the mortgage market, Bloomberg reported on Thursday.
“I recently tried to refinance my mortgage and I was unsuccessful in doing so,” Bernanke said, speaking at a conference in Chicago, according to Bloomberg.

OK, more at the Wall Street Journal: Tight Credit? Why Ben Bernanke Couldn’t Refinance His Mortgage
- Lenders have grown to rely heavily on automated underwriting systems and the requisite documentation of borrower incomes, the sources of their down-payment funds and anything else that’s fed into those computers to determine whether a borrower qualifies for a loan.
This can result in the odd situation in which a perfectly qualified borrower might find a loan officer who’s unwilling to process a loan.
